Age | Commit message (Expand) | Author | Files | Lines |
2014-12-13 | mm/memblock.c: refactor functions to set/clear MEMBLOCK_HOTPLUG | ![](https://seccdn.libravatar.org/avatar/97a86ccb04dc44d68b465c7e98d2ac5c?s=13&d=retro) Tony Luck | 1 | -23/+20 |
2014-09-10 | mem-hotplug: let memblock skip the hotpluggable memory regions in __next_mem_range() | ![](https://seccdn.libravatar.org/avatar/2ecb767de5cad4e30ca6fb7135a22f10?s=13&d=retro) Xishi Qiu | 1 | -0/+4 |
2014-08-29 | memblock, memhotplug: fix wrong type in memblock_find_in_range_node(). |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-2/+1 |
2014-06-06 | mm/memblock.c: call kmemleak directly from memblock_(alloc|free) | ![](https://seccdn.libravatar.org/avatar/23136fca891d323c70dc6c149d66bfeb?s=13&d=retro) Catalin Marinas | 1 | -2/+8 |
2014-06-04 | mm/memblock.c: use PFN_DOWN | ![](https://seccdn.libravatar.org/avatar/de7d8a37037267c0ded17dc83069df0b?s=13&d=retro) Fabian Frederick | 1 | -3/+2 |
2014-06-04 | memblock: introduce memblock_alloc_range() | ![](https://seccdn.libravatar.org/avatar/22206aa12fd58bbc58f280dc632c1c79?s=13&d=retro) Akinobu Mita | 1 | -4/+17 |
2014-05-20 | mm/memblock: add physical memory list | ![](https://seccdn.libravatar.org/avatar/39c8e3b3572e452a53b283240a8116b0?s=13&d=retro) Philipp Hachtmann | 1 | -0/+12 |
2014-05-20 | mm/memblock: Do some refactoring, enhance API | ![](https://seccdn.libravatar.org/avatar/39c8e3b3572e452a53b283240a8116b0?s=13&d=retro) Philipp Hachtmann | 1 | -71/+122 |
2014-04-07 | mm/memblock.c: use PFN_PHYS() | ![](https://seccdn.libravatar.org/avatar/de7d8a37037267c0ded17dc83069df0b?s=13&d=retro) Fabian Frederick | 1 | -2/+2 |
2014-04-07 | memblock: use for_each_memblock() | ![](https://seccdn.libravatar.org/avatar/3895640111806ea7b122678de53ccdf4?s=13&d=retro) Emil Medve | 1 | -13/+11 |
2014-03-12 | ARM: 7993/1: mm/memblock: add memblock_get_current_limit | ![](https://seccdn.libravatar.org/avatar/e604b7a7c77b283eea631ac5bc3266a6?s=13&d=retro) Laura Abbott | 1 | -0/+5 |
2014-01-29 | memblock: add limit checking to memblock_virt_alloc |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-0/+3 |
2014-01-27 | memblock: don't silently align size in memblock_virt_alloc() |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-6/+0 |
2014-01-23 | mm/nobootmem: free_all_bootmem again | ![](https://seccdn.libravatar.org/avatar/39c8e3b3572e452a53b283240a8116b0?s=13&d=retro) Philipp Hachtmann | 1 | -15/+2 |
2014-01-23 | mm: free memblock.memory in free_all_bootmem | ![](https://seccdn.libravatar.org/avatar/39c8e3b3572e452a53b283240a8116b0?s=13&d=retro) Philipp Hachtmann | 1 | -0/+16 |
2014-01-21 | mm/memblock: use WARN_ONCE when MAX_NUMNODES passed as input parameter |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-13/+8 |
2014-01-21 | mm/memblock: add memblock memory allocation apis | ![](https://seccdn.libravatar.org/avatar/6b076bfc37effc81fc474fd7b4676d7e?s=13&d=retro) Santosh Shilimkar | 1 | -2/+207 |
2014-01-21 | mm/memblock: switch to use NUMA_NO_NODE instead of MAX_NUMNODES |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-9/+19 |
2014-01-21 | mm/memblock: reorder parameters of memblock_find_in_range_node |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-8/+8 |
2014-01-21 | mm/memblock: drop WARN and use SMP_CACHE_BYTES as a default alignment |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-2/+2 |
2014-01-21 | mm/memblock: debug: don't free reserved array if !ARCH_DISCARD_MEMBLOCK |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-0/+13 |
2014-01-21 | memblock, mem_hotplug: make memblock skip hotpluggable regions if needed |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-0/+12 |
2014-01-21 | memblock: make memblock_set_node() support different memblock_type |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-3/+3 |
2014-01-21 | memblock, mem_hotplug: introduce MEMBLOCK_HOTPLUG flag to mark hotpluggable regions |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-0/+53 |
2014-01-21 | memblock, numa: introduce flags field into memblock |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-15/+38 |
2014-01-21 | mm/memblock: debug: correct displaying of upper memory boundary | ![](https://seccdn.libravatar.org/avatar/010a2969e49cd658f7a7498a58e7e840?s=13&d=retro) Grygorii Strashko | 1 | -2/+2 |
2013-11-13 | mm/memblock.c: introduce bottom-up allocation mode |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-3/+80 |
2013-11-13 | mm/memblock.c: factor out of top-down allocation |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-13/+34 |
2013-09-11 | memblock, numa: binary search node id |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-0/+18 |
2013-07-09 | mm/memblock.c: fix wrong comment in __next_free_mem_range() |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-1/+1 |
2013-04-29 | memblock: fix missing comment of memblock_insert_region() |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-4/+5 |
2013-04-29 | memblock: add assertion for zero allocation alignment | ![](https://seccdn.libravatar.org/avatar/6b7501ea98af7d2e1d3748c94b3682ef?s=13&d=retro) Vineet Gupta | 1 | -0/+3 |
2013-03-02 | x86, ACPI, mm: Revert movablemem_map support |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-50/+0 |
2013-02-23 | mm/memblock.c: use CONFIG_HAVE_MEMBLOCK_NODE_MAP to protect movablecore_map in memblock_overlaps_region(). |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-0/+34 |
2013-02-23 | page_alloc: bootmem limit with movablecore_map | ![](https://seccdn.libravatar.org/avatar/5ace37a51ec77a64ed29b54d7d507cb5?s=13&d=retro) Tang Chen | 1 | -1/+17 |
2013-01-29 | memblock: Add memblock_mem_size() |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-0/+17 |
2013-01-11 | mm: memblock: fix wrong memmove size in memblock_merge_regions() | ![](https://seccdn.libravatar.org/avatar/09c8615a4a36affbd35ec122e7f2defa?s=13&d=retro) Lin Feng | 1 | -1/+2 |
2012-10-24 | x86, mm: Trim memory in memblock to be page aligned |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-0/+24 |
2012-10-09 | mm: avoid section mismatch warning for memblock_type_name | ![](https://seccdn.libravatar.org/avatar/541085fbe80e51dd193c3e2dd24a123f?s=13&d=retro) Raghavendra D Prabhu | 1 | -1/+2 |
2012-10-09 | mm/memblock: use existing interface to set nid | ![](https://seccdn.libravatar.org/avatar/4e21b6c66f84dd0f75c24e8c5eafe5a6?s=13&d=retro) Wanpeng Li | 1 | -1/+1 |
2012-09-05 | mm/memblock: Use NULL instead of 0 for pointers | ![](https://seccdn.libravatar.org/avatar/237e490ea8c728a6082661383b79b1e4?s=13&d=retro) Sachin Kamat | 1 | -1/+1 |
2012-07-31 | mm/memblock.c:memblock_double_array(): cosmetic cleanups | ![](https://seccdn.libravatar.org/avatar/cb179c77d7ef828ce407a6f1741b47e0?s=13&d=retro) Andrew Morton | 1 | -17/+18 |
2012-07-11 | memblock: free allocated memblock_reserved_regions later | ![](https://seccdn.libravatar.org/avatar/dcda7f018049c2aff2ce2aaceaff6196?s=13&d=retro) Yinghai Lu | 1 | -28/+23 |
2012-06-20 | mm/memblock: fix overlapping allocation when doubling reserved array | ![](https://seccdn.libravatar.org/avatar/3682a40438aceed22e465a16438e667e?s=13&d=retro) Greg Pearson | 1 | -4/+32 |
2012-06-20 | mm: fix kernel-doc warnings | ![](https://seccdn.libravatar.org/avatar/6a5de3b9907e493615ac763c0dd15a59?s=13&d=retro) Wanpeng Li | 1 | -6/+6 |
2012-06-08 | memblock: Document memblock_is_region_{memory,reserved}() | ![](https://seccdn.libravatar.org/avatar/82e678bf46683e0db279df189ffdee71?s=13&d=retro) Stephen Boyd | 1 | -0/+20 |
2012-05-29 | mm/memblock: fix memory leak on extending regions | ![](https://seccdn.libravatar.org/avatar/38d3da3c17c3ee97b66c5db91c292df0?s=13&d=retro) Gavin Shan | 1 | -13/+24 |
2012-05-29 | mm/memblock: cleanup on duplicate VA/PA conversion | ![](https://seccdn.libravatar.org/avatar/38d3da3c17c3ee97b66c5db91c292df0?s=13&d=retro) Gavin Shan | 1 | -2/+3 |
2012-04-20 | memblock: memblock should be able to handle zero length operations | ![](https://seccdn.libravatar.org/avatar/3153fad76e09b4fe37ddc74d32312eb4?s=13&d=retro) Tejun Heo | 1 | -1/+6 |
2012-03-01 | memblock: Fix size aligning of memblock_alloc_base_nid() | ![](https://seccdn.libravatar.org/avatar/3153fad76e09b4fe37ddc74d32312eb4?s=13&d=retro) Tejun Heo | 1 | -3/+3 |